|
def | hasFactory (self, id) |
| bool hasFactory(const Identifier& id)
|
|
def | getIdentifiers (self) |
| std::vector<Identifier> getIdentifiers()
|
|
def | addFactory (self, id, creator, destructor) |
| ReturnCode addFactory(const Identifier& id, Creator creator, Destructor destructor)
|
|
def | removeFactory (self, id) |
| ReturnCode removeFactory(const Identifier& id)
|
|
def | createObject (self, id) |
| AbstractClass* createObject(const Identifier& id)
|
|
def | deleteObject (self, obj, id=None) |
| ReturnCode deleteObject(const Identifier& id, AbstractClass*& obj)
|
|
def | createdObjects (self) |
| 生成済みオブジェクトリストの取得 [詳解]
|
|
def | isProducerOf (self, obj) |
| オブジェクトがこのファクトリの生成物かどうか調べる [詳解]
|
|
def | objectToIdentifier (self, obj, id) |
| オブジェクトからクラス識別子(ID)を取得する [詳解]
|
|
def | objectToCreator (self, obj) |
| オブジェクトのコンストラクタを取得する [詳解]
|
|
def | objectToDestructor (self, obj) |
| オブジェクトのデストラクタを取得する [詳解]
|
|
def | __init__ (self) |
| コンストラクタ [詳解]
|
|
def | publishInterfaceProfile (self, prop) |
| InterfaceProfile情報を公開する [詳解]
|
|
def | publishInterface (self, prop) |
| Interface情報を公開する [詳解]
|
|
def | setPortType (self, port_type) |
| ポートタイプを設定する [詳解]
|
|
def | setDataType (self, data_type) |
| データタイプを設定する [詳解]
|
|
def | setInterfaceType (self, interface_type) |
| インターフェースタイプを設定する [詳解]
|
|
def | setDataFlowType (self, dataflow_type) |
| データフロータイプを設定する [詳解]
|
|
def | setSubscriptionType (self, subs_type) |
| サブスクリプションタイプを設定する [詳解]
|
|
def | toString (status) |
| DataPortStatus リターンコードを文字列に変換 [詳解]
|
|
int | PORT_OK = 0 |
| brief DataPortStatus リターンコード [詳解]
|
|